IWAS World Games, Bangalore 2009

IWAS World Games, Bangalore 2009

Location

Bangalore, India

Date

24th November – 1st December 2009

Sports Programme

Archery, Athletics, Badminton, Powelifting, Shooting, Sitting Volleyball, Swimming, Table Tennis, Wheelchair Fencing & Wheelchair Rugby

The 2009 IWAS World Games featured an impressive 10 sports in a festival of Para sport competition and growth.

Two of these – table tennis and sitting volleyball – were demonstration events as the sports widened their international competition programme. Development activities were also held for wheelchair rugby.

Nearly 500 athletes from 40 countries competed overall in these sports and in swimming, archery, athletics, badminton, shooting, powerlifting and wheelchair fencing.

China topped the medals table in the year after they hosted the Beijing 2008 Paralympic Games, showing the world that they had become a dominant force.
